如何安装GnuPG 2.0?


29

在Ubuntu 15.10中,将Mozilla Thunderbird与Enigmail一起使用时,出现以下警告(瑞典语):

DuanvänderGnuPG 1.4.18版,vilken intelängrestöds。EnigmailkräverGnuPG版本2.0.7版本。可以在Enigmail中安装GnuPG annars fungerar。

据我了解,我的GnuPG版本太旧了,我需要升级。但是,我不知道该怎么做。

在Enigmail常见问题解答中,我读到:

您可以通过发行版的常规软件包管理系统(例如apt,yum,yast)安装GnuPG 2.0。在许多发行版中,程序包称为“ gnupg2”或“ gpg2”。

但是我只是普通用户,我不明白这意味着什么以及我打算做什么。

我会很高兴为您提供帮助。例如,一种非常基本的逐步操作指南。

Answers:


44

在Ubuntu上,GnuPG 2.0可用于所有受支持的发行版,软件包名称为gnupg2(且所有版本均大于2.0.7)。要安装它,请打开一个终端(按CtrlAltT)并运行以下命令:

sudo apt-get install gnupg2

或参阅如何使用Ubuntu软件中心安装软件?


7
应该注意的是,由于二进制版本仍然是版本1 ,因此不会安装gpg二进制文件。您必须然后sudo apt-get remove gnupgsudo ln -s /usr/bin/gpg2 /usr/bin/gpg
Sukima,

或者,您可能希望gpg在遇到任何问题时保持可用,因此您始终可以致电gpg2以使用新版本。
蒂姆·马隆

至少对于现在的Ubuntu 18.04和我来说:(1)该gnupg2软件包不可用,(2)报告中的命令已报告However the following packages replace it: gpgv gpgsm gnupg-l10n gnupg dirmngr,以及(3)sudo apt-get install gpgv gpgsm gnupg-l10n gnupg dirmngr报告所有这些软件包已为最新。也许他们带有我的Ubuntu映像。希望对您有帮助...
BaldEagle

1
@BaldEagle是的,在18.04中,gnupg程序包是GnuPG 2,并且gnupg2是Universe中可用的虚拟程序包。
muru

1
Ubuntu存储库中的版本为2.1.11,比当前的2.2.8版本落后。这很烦人,因为在GitHub上签署提交需要v2.1.17或更高版本。
Dan Dascalescu '18
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.